Residential Plumbing Slab Leak Detection
Turn to the World Leader in Non-Invasive Slab Leak Detection!
If your home is built on a slab, most likely the hot and cold water lines are underneath your slab. Since this plumbing is so well hidden, finding a slab leak is especially difficult—unless you call American Leak Detection. Plumbing leaks can cost thousands of dollars. Resolving the problem can also be very expensive, especially if unskilled professionals are using "hit and miss" search or replacement strategies.
If a water meter is moving when no water is being used or your pump is constantly running, there is a leak in the potable water plumbing (i.e. drinking water plumbing). Sometimes the leak is in the service line that runs from the meter or pump to the house. More often the leak is hidden in either the hot or cold water lines beneath your home. Our efforts to locate a slab leak include tracking the plumbing lines, pressure testing the lines to determine whether there is a leak in the system; and, if there is a leak, determining the location of the water loss and marking the location.
